Joseph Villanueva
Joined Artfinder: January 2019
Artworks for sale: 369
Location Australia
£987 Sold
£494 Sold
£443 Sold
£395 Sold
£346 Sold
£370 Sold
£721 Sold
£173 Sold
£247 Sold
£222 Sold
By submitting this form you do not commit to follow through with the commission.